Radiation Therapy With Protons or Photons in Treating Patients With Liver Cancer

Complete Title: A Phase III Randomized Trial of Protons Versus Photons For Hepatocellular Carcinoma
Trial Phase: III
Investigator: Smith Apisarnthanarax

This phase III trial studies how well radiation therapy with protons works compared with photons in treating patients with liver cancer. Radiation therapy, such as photon therapy, uses high energy x-rays to send the radiation inside the body to the tumor while proton therapy uses a beam of proton particles. Proton therapy can stop shortly after penetrating through the tumor and may cause less damage to the surrounding healthy organs and result in better survival in patients with liver cancer.
